Last Updated at 11 October 2024CHARKA SSK: A Rural Primary School in West Bengal
CHARKA SSK, a primary school located in the rural KESHPUR block of PASCHIM MEDINIPUR district, West Bengal, offers a glimpse into the educational landscape of this region. Established in 2000 and managed by the Department of Education, the school serves students from Class 1 to Class 4. Its co-educational structure includes a pre-primary section, catering to a broader range of young learners.
The school's infrastructure comprises a government building housing four classrooms, all reportedly in good condition. While lacking a playground and library, the school does boast functional hand pumps providing drinking water, and separate boys' and girls' toilets. The building features a pucca but broken wall, and importantly, has access to electricity.
Instruction at CHARKA SSK is delivered in Bengali, and the school provides mid-day meals prepared on the premises. The school's accessibility is enhanced by its location on an all-weather road, allowing for year-round attendance. The academic session begins in April, adhering to the standard academic calendar.
The teaching staff consists entirely of four female teachers, underscoring the significant female representation in education in this particular setting.
